Top Non-Fiction Books Exploring Everyday Science

  • “The Science of Everyday Life” by David Macaulay – This book explores the physics, chemistry, and biology behind common phenomena, from cooking to weather patterns.
  • “The Secret Life of Trees” by Colin Tudge – A detailed look at how trees grow, communicate, and sustain life around them.
  • “Why Do We Sleep?” by Matthew Walker – An insightful examination of sleep, its importance, and the science behind our nightly rest.
  • “The Invisible Universe” by Trinh Xuan Thuan – This book reveals the science of light, color, and perception in our everyday experiences.
  • “The Brain’s Way of Healing” by Norman Doidge – Exploring how the brain adapts and heals through everyday activities and phenomena.
